Key Ingredients
Plain Greek Yogurt (1 cup)
Plain Greek yogurt serves as the foundation of this bread, providing moisture and a rich source of protein. Its creamy texture helps bind the ingredients together, resulting in a soft, tender loaf.
Almond Flour (1 cup)
Almond flour is a low-carb alternative to traditional wheat flour, making it perfect for those following a keto or low-carb diet. It adds a nutty flavor and contributes healthy fats and fiber, enhancing the nutritional profile of the bread.
Coconut Flour (1/4 cup)
Coconut flour is another gluten-free ingredient that absorbs moisture effectively, contributing to the bread’s structure. It adds a subtle sweetness and a light texture while keeping the carb count low.
Large Eggs (2)
Eggs are essential for binding the ingredients, providing structure, and adding protein. They help the bread rise and contribute to its overall flavor and richness.
Baking Powder (1 tbsp)
Baking powder is a leavening agent that helps the bread rise, creating a light and airy texture. It’s crucial for achieving the perfect loaf that doesn’t feel dense or heavy.
Salt (1 tsp)
Salt enhances the flavors of the other ingredients, balancing the taste and making the bread more enjoyable. It’s a small but vital ingredient in any baked good.
Garlic Powder (1/4 tsp, optional)
Garlic powder can add a hint of savory flavor to the bread, making it a delicious option for savory dishes or sandwiches. Feel free to omit it if you prefer a more neutral taste.
Onion Powder (1/4 tsp, optional)
Similar to garlic powder, onion powder can enhance the flavor profile of the bread with a subtle sweetness and depth. It’s great for those who enjoy a little extra flavor in their baked goods.

Cooking Tips and Notes
When making Zero Carb Yogurt Bread, there are a few tips to elevate your baking experience and ensure a successful loaf. First, make sure your Greek yogurt is at room temperature before mixing; this helps create a smoother dough and better texture in the final product.
Proper Mixing Techniques
Mixing the ingredients until just combined is key. Overmixing can lead to a denser bread, which isn’t what you want. Once the dough forms, stop mixing and prepare to bake. Also, consider using a rubber spatula to fold the ingredients gently to keep the mixture light and airy.
Baking Tips
To achieve that perfect golden-brown crust, keep an eye on your bread as it bakes. Every oven is different, so check for doneness a few minutes before the recommended baking time. A toothpick inserted into the center should come out clean when your bread is ready.
Additionally, letting the bread cool completely before slicing is crucial. This allows the texture to set, making it easier to slice without crumbling. Store any leftovers in an airtight container to keep it fresh for up to a week, and remember that toasting the slices can add an extra layer of deliciousness!

PrintZero Carb Yogurt Bread
A delicious and healthy bread alternative made with yogurt.
- Prep Time: 10 minutes
- Cook Time: 35 minutes
- Total Time: 45 minutes
- Yield: 1 loaf 1x
- Category: Bread
- Method: Baking
- Cuisine: American
- Diet: Low Carb
Ingredients
- 1 cup plain Greek yogurt
- 1 cup almond flour
- 1/4 cup coconut flour
- 2 large eggs
- 1 tbsp baking powder
- 1 tsp salt
- 1/4 tsp garlic powder (optional)
- 1/4 tsp onion powder (optional)
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C).
- In a large bowl, combine the Greek yogurt, almond flour, coconut flour, eggs, baking powder, salt, and optional spices.
- Mix until a dough forms and is well combined.
- Grease a loaf pan and pour the dough into it, spreading it evenly.
- Bake for 30-35 minutes or until golden brown and a toothpick comes out clean.
- Let it cool before slicing and serving.
Notes
- Store in an airtight container for up to a week.
- This bread can be toasted for extra crispiness.
- Great for sandwiches or as a side with meals.
